Our senior dogs are proudly sponsored by The Grey Muzzle Organization, meaning there is no adoption fee to welcome one of these wonderful dogs into your home! While the adoption fee is waived, we provide these dogs "as-is," and we ask that all potential adopters fully embrace the unique reality of a senior companion. Please be prepared for these common, graceful signs of aging: Mobility: A senior dog won't move like a 2-year-old; expect mild stiffness or arthritis. Sensory & Vitality: You may notice slight cloudiness in the eyes, hearing loss, or common, age-related heart murmurs. Dental Health: Due to past life as a stray, many seniors have compromised dental health. These are natural, non-emergency findings that come with age. If you are not prepared for a dog that acts and moves like a senior, we kindly ask that you explore adopting a younger dog instead.
